Available Tests
The testing section within Cambrionix Connect is designed to ensure that your hubs are performing as expected and without issues. The following table lists the tests you can run using this facility, along with their descriptions:
| Test | Description |
|---|---|
| Test Hub's ID Response | Validates that the hub returns sensible information in response to its 'id' command. This includes checking that the firmware version is at least 1.79 and that it is in the correct mode. |
| ModIT Gate Configuration | For ModIT Pro hubs with lockable gates, this test verifies that the configuration is correct. |
| ModIT Gate Exerciser | For ModIT Pro hubs with lockable gates, this test validates that the gates open and close within the expected time and that their current draw is within reasonable limits. |
| Validate Hub Health | Checks that there are no hub error flags set. |
| Hub Settings | Ensures the hub returns sensible information in response to its 'settings_display' command. |
| Validate Port Health | Verifies that there are no port error flags set on individual ports. |
| Validate USB | Validates the hub's USB functionality. |
| API Validation | Ensures that the API is functioning and is of a suitable version for other tests. |
Testing Pages
The Testing section in Cambrionix Connect comprises three pages:
- Test Selected Hubs: Allows selection of specific hubs to test.
- Automatic Testing: Automatically runs all tests on all connected hubs.
- Configuration: Enables selection of tests to run in both Automatic and Selected mode and configuration of test values for passing criteria.
Conducting Tests
To conduct tests:
- Navigate to the Testing section under Settings.
- Choose between Test Selected Hubs for specific hubs or Automatic Testing for all hubs.
- In Configuration, you can customize which tests are performed and their passing criteria.
